Treating dual substance abuse: Drug abuse and mental health

The problems associated with misuse of drugs can be very fatal in one’s health and that is why in treating dual substance abuse and mental health disorders it is important noting that these (substances) can interact with, and even lead to, the presence of other disorders. The substance abuse and mental health services administration reports that approximately 53 percent of individuals who use drugs have at least one mental health disorder. Because the two illnesses can aggravate one another, it can sometimes be difficult to determine which symptoms are caused by which problem. Appreciating the need for dual diagnosis

According to the National Institute on Drug Abuse, substance abuse and mental health disorders frequently occur together. In particular, substance abuse problems may often occur with the following types of mental health disorders:

  • Post-traumatic stress disorder
  • Anxiety
  • Schizophrenia
  • Depression
  • Personality disorders

Alcoholic beverages nutritional value: Empty calories and weight gain

When pointing out at alcohol addiction role in malnutrition and liver intoxication, the main reason behind it would be the nutritional value of alcohol if any. Experts at AWAREmed Health and Wellness Resource Center are in agreement that the water forms the greatest content of alcohol, followed by pure alcohol also known as ethanol and inconstant quantities of sugar (carbohydrates). The other content of alcohol like proteins, vitamin, and minerals are usually very negligible. And since these nutrients are considered negligible leaving water and ethanol as the main factors, alcoholic beverages nutritional value are often considered as empty calories. This therefore means that, any calories provided by alcoholic beverages are derived from the carbohydrates and alcohol they contain. And remember that the carbohydrate content usually varies greatly among beverage types.

Alcoholic beverages nutritional value: Alcohol derived calories

At least under certain conditions, however, alcohol–derived calories when consumed in substantial amounts can have less biologic value than carbohydrate–derived calories, as shown in a study where two groups of participants who received balanced diets containing equal numbers of calories. In one of the groups, 50 percent of total calories were derived from carbohydrates, whereas in the other group the calories were derived from alcohol. The study participants were observed on the metabolic ward of a hospital during the experiments. The quantity of alcohol administered did not exceed the amount routinely consumed by these volunteers.

Although all participants received the same number of calories, those in the alcohol group exhibited a decline in body weight compared with those in the carbohydrate group. Moreover, when the participants received additional calories in the form of alcohol, they did not experience any corresponding weight gain. This suggests that some of the energy contained in alcohol is “lost” or “wasted” meaning, it is not valuable to the body for producing or maintaining body mass.

Unlocking alcohol addiction role in malnutrition: The nutrition content

Doctor Dalal Akoury says that the effects of alcohol abuse is actually felt in all homes either directly and indirectly and that is causing many alcoholics malnourished, either because they ingest too little of essential nutrients like carbohydrates, proteins, and vitamins or because alcohol and its metabolism prevented their body from properly absorbing, digesting and making good use of those nutrients. The consequences of this is that many alcohol users particularly the alcoholics, they suffer frequent deficiencies of vital nutrients including proteins and vitamins, and more so vitamin A, which may contribute to liver disease and other serious alcohol–related disorders.

Nevertheless doctor Akoury acknowledges that a complex relationship do exists between an individual’s alcohol consumption and his or her nutritional status. Majority of users of alcohol whether those abusing it or those taking in moderation or light drinkers who consume one to two glasses or less of an alcoholic beverage per day, consider those beverages a part of their normal diet and acquire a certain number of calories from them. When consumed in excess, however, alcohol can cause diseases by interfering with the nutritional status of the user. For example, alcohol can alter the intake, absorption into the body, and utilization of various nutrients. In addition, alcohol exerts some harmful effects through its breakdown (i.e., metabolism) and the resulting toxic compounds, particularly in the liver, where most of the alcohol metabolism occurs.
